Outreach and Education Advisory Panel (OEAP) Report to the Council 152nd CFMC Regular Meeting April 21-22, 2015 St.Croix, USVI
Importance of O & E National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ration Education Strategic Plan 2015-2035: Advancing NOAA s Mission through Education ( Draft for public comments March 2015) NOAA s Education Mission (pp. 4) Education plays a significant role in supporting NOAA s mission. In order for society to become more resilient, individuals must have the ability to understand scientific processes, consider uncertainty, and reason about the ways that human and natural systems interact. Therefore, it is not enough for NOAA to research Earth systems; NOAA must also deliver this information into the hands of individuals who, in turn, understand the science and know how to respond accordingly. 7/14/14 Alida Ortiz, OEAP Chairperson 3
The Magnuson-Stevens Fishery Conservation and Management Act 1976, 2006 is one of the statutes that sustain NOAA s Education Strategy. SERO Strategic Goals include: Goal 4 aims to promote public stewardship of NOAA trust resources and increase capacity to achieve organizational priorities. 7/14/14 Alida Ortiz, OEAP Chairperson 4
CFMCs O & E Experiencies PEPCO, MREP/Caribbean Initiative, Don t Stop Talking Fish, St. Croix Fishing Heritage, Fishers participation in Scoping Meetings, Calendars, Fact Sheets to clarify scientific and management concepts. 7/14/14 Alida Ortiz, OEAP Chairperson 5
Results of O & E Efforts Evidence increase in participation and interest in learning more about the science underlying fisheries management decissions. Fishers are participating in field research and initiatives for new and innovation of traditional gear. Presentations to college students promotes interest in fisheries biology, economics and managemnet. 7/14/14 Alida Ortiz, OEAP Chairperson 6

PEPCO (Programa de Educaci n de Pesca Comercial Fondos provistos por el Negociado de Pesca y Vida Silvestre del DRNA, el CFMC y The Nature Conservancy (TNC). In general, excellent evaluations from participants and resources. 7/14/14 Alida Ortiz, OEAP Chairperson 9
PEPCO (Programa de Educaci n de Pesca Comercial La participaci n de los pescadores sobrepas las expectativas, los cuales eran entre 10-20 pescadores por curso para un 80-160 total. Pero logramos contar con un total de 292 participantes con 225 participantes certificados por haber completado el curso . Helena Antoun PEPCO Coordinator 7/14/14 Alida Ortiz, OEAP Chairperson 10
Outreach & Education Priorities for 2015 -2020 Conduct 2 MREP training sessions in USVI and PR (Eastern coast) 30K each Initiate campaign for Sustainable Seafood Campaign partnering with TNC and UPRSG 20K Calendars 10K Caribbean Fisheries Resource Book for Teachers 15K
Outreach & Education Priorities for 2015 -2020 Produce Fact Sheets/Infographic on: New lobster traps Octopus life cycle Forage fish Handling Fresh Tuna fish Essential Fish Habitats Fishing calendars and regulations 5K Small posters for restaurants, marinas, fishers associations, cleaning stations and fish markets 3K
